SUMMARY

The tension between what we can know on our own and what must be revealed by God runs through this reflection. Tim unpacks how the Sunday readings highlight revelation as a gift we need for the journey of faith, from Elijah's encounter with the Lord in a still, small voice to Paul's sorrow over Israel's great gifts. He then turns to the Gospel scene of Jesus walking on the water, where the disciples move from terror to the confession that Jesus is the Son of God. Along the way, he shows how these passages point to the Eucharist, perseverance, and the supernatural help needed to endure. The result is a vivid reminder that faith is not self-made, but sustained by God's word and grace.
